The Exchange After the Game
After a recent Lakers game, Stephen A. Smith recounted an intense interaction with LeBron James. During the post-game discussion about LeBron’s son, LeBron approached Smith to address some of his commentary. In a moment charged with bravado, Smith declared that had LeBron laid a hand on him, he would have responded physically without hesitation.

Contrasting Profiles and Realities
A closer look reveals a striking contrast between the two figures. Smith, a veteran commentator known more for his outspoken opinions than athletic prowess, stands at 6-foot-1 and is in his late fifties, having never competed at the top levels of professional sports. In stark contrast, LeBron James boasts an impressive physical stature—standing 6-foot-9, weighing 250 pounds, and displaying the athleticism of a prime competitor well into his 40s. This juxtaposition highlights the dramatic difference in backgrounds and the realms in which they excel.
